Bids Recieved For City WPA Water Project

Bids were received for Vernal City's WPA water main extension project after approval of $13,500 WPA funds and $1,600 local match. Contractors include Utah Concrete Products Westerm Pipe and Steel Consolidated Steel and others. final award pending Vernal City and WPA committee approval. About 100 men currently work on the sewer project.

Change Name of South 40 to Highway No 24

A proposed name change would rename the South 40 highway in Colorado to Highway No 24. The road runs from Pontiac Michigan to Grand Junction, with No 24 designation to Kansas City and becomes South 40 beyond. A final decision awaits a National Association of State Highway Officials meeting in Florida next month.

Mary S Christensen Early Pioneer Buried

Mary Christensen, 83, pioneer of East Lake City and Ashby Valley, died after weeks of cancer and old age ailments. Funeral services were held Saturday at 11 am in the Vero Nel Second Ward chapel with Charles Carter presiding. Interment followed at Maeser cemetery. Christensen sailed from Liverpool in 1832 and arrived in Utah in 1868, facing hardship on emigration with her husband and children before settling in Salt Lake City and working for ZCMI.

Soy Bean Raising to Be Tested in Uintah Basin

A planned experimental test of soy bean raising in Uintah Basin aims to assess adaptability for eastern Utah farmers. Initiated after Salt Lake Chamber of Commerce secretary P Backian requested Department of Agriculture support, the effort targets a staple crop with food feed and industrial uses, optimistic a profitable variety will thrive in the area.

Conference to Seek Federal Aid for Forest Road Highways

Salt Lake Chamber officials propose a western states conference in Salt Lake next month with representatives from the U S bureau of public roads forest service interior department and state highway departments. The aim is to boost federal funds to standardize forest and public land highways now 10 to 20 years behind.

Vernal Flyers Injured In Plane Crash Near Airport

Vernal pilots Thomas Karren and passenger DeVere Carroll were severely injured when their plane crashed during a landing at Vernal City Airport Sunday evening. Both were transported to Salt Lake hospitals, with Karren later at Holy Cross and Carroll at LS. Witnesses described a gusty approach, plane damage, and fuel leakage but no ignition.
